ADRF6602
EVALUATION BOARD CONFIGURATION OPTIONS
Table 10.

Description
LO select. Switch and resistors to ground the LODRV_EN pin. The LODRV_EN pin setting, in
combination with internal register settings, determines whether the LOP and LON pins
function as inputs or outputs (see the LO Selection Logic section for more information).
LO input/output. An external 1× LO or 2× LO can be applied to this single-ended input
connector.
Reference input. The input reference frequency for the PLL is applied to this connector.
Input impedance is 50 Ω.
Multiplexer output. The REFOUT connector connects directly to the MUXOUT pin. The
on-board multiplexer can be programmed to bring out the following signals: REFIN, 2×
REFIN, REFIN/2, and REFIN/4; temperature sensor output voltage; and lock detect indicator.
Charge pump test point. The unfiltered charge pump signal can be probed at this test
point. Note that the CP pin should not be probed during critical measurements such as
phase noise.
Loop filter. Loop filter components.
Loop filter return. When the internal VCO is used, the loop filter components should be
returned to Pin 40 (DECLVCO) by installing a 0 Ω resistor in R12. When an external VCO is used,
the loop filter components can be returned to ground by installing a 0 Ω resistor in R11.
Internal vs. external VCO. When the internal VCO is enabled, the loop filter components are
connected directly to the VTUNE pin (Pin 39) by installing a 0 Ω resistor in R62. To use an
external VCO, R62 should be left open. A 0 Ω resistor should be installed in R63, and the
voltage input of the VCO should be connected to the VTUNE SMA connector. The output of
the VCO is brought back into the PLL via the LO IN/OUT SMA connector.
R
RF input. The RF input signal should be applied to the RFIN SMA connector. The RF input of
the ADRF6602 is ac-coupled, so no bias is necessary.
IF output. The differential IF output signals from the ADRF6602 (IFP and IFN) are converted
to a single-ended signal by T3.
